Understanding Russian Taxation for Australians Doing Business in Russia

Australia and Russia are both vast countries with unique business opportunities. As an Australian entrepreneur looking to expand your business into the Russian market, it is crucial to understand the taxation system in Russia to avoid any compliance issues and financial penalties. In this blog post, we will explore the key aspects of Russian taxation that Australian businesses need to be aware of. Income tax In Russia, income tax is levied on both individuals and corporations. Individual income tax rates range from 13% to 30% depending on the level of income, with a flat rate of 13% for most taxpayers. For corporations, the standard corporate income tax rate is 20%. It is important to note that Russia operates on a self-assessment system, and businesses are required to file tax returns and pay their taxes on time. Value Added Tax (VAT) VAT is a key component of the Russian tax system, with a standard rate of 20%. Certain goods and services may be subject to a reduced VAT rate of 10% or be exempt from VAT altogether. Australian businesses operating in Russia need to ensure they are compliant with VAT regulations and properly account for VAT in their financial records. Withholding Tax Russia imposes withholding tax on payments made to foreign companies and individuals. The withholding tax rates vary depending on the type of income, with rates ranging from 0% to 20%. It is essential for Australian businesses to understand their withholding tax obligations when conducting transactions with Russian entities. Transfer Pricing Rules Transfer pricing rules in Russia require related party transactions to be conducted at arm's length. Australian businesses operating in Russia must ensure that their transfer pricing policies are compliant with Russian regulations to avoid penalties and audits by the tax authorities. Tax Treaties Australia and Russia have a tax treaty in place to prevent double taxation and promote cross-border trade and investment. The treaty covers various aspects of taxation, including income tax, withholding tax, and capital gains tax. Australian businesses operating in Russia can benefit from the provisions of the tax treaty to optimize their tax liabilities. In conclusion, understanding Russian taxation is essential for Australian businesses looking to expand into the Russian market. By familiarizing yourself with the key aspects of the Russian tax system, you can navigate the complexities of taxation in Russia and ensure compliance with local regulations. Consulting with tax advisors and legal experts with knowledge of both Australian and Russian tax laws can help you establish a tax-efficient business operation in Russia.
